Taj Mahal, other monuments to not reopen as COVID-19 cases soar in Agra

In wake of the current coronavirus situation in Agra, the district administration of the city has decided to keep all the historical monuments including Taj Mahal closed until further orders.

As per the District Magistrate, 55 new cases of COVID-19 reported in the past four days and there are also 71 containment zones in Agra, citing the risk of new COVID-19 infections spreading in the city as tourists will come to see the monuments if they are opened.

Earlier, Union Minister of Tourism and Culture Prahlad Singh Patel announced that all Archaeological Survey of India (ASI) protected monuments will reopen from July 6.

On Sunday, the Health Ministry reported a record single-day spike of 24,850 new COVID-19 cases, taking the overall tally to 673,165 cases.
